We’re set to have a punishing heatwave this week, with temperatures forecast to reach 38 degrees in some areas.
MeteoSwiss says the mercury will rise from today, with peak heat expected on Sunday and Monday across much of the country.
The June record of 36.9, set in Basel back in 1947, could fall this week, with records also under threat at Zurich Airport and in Lugano.
From tomorrow, isolated thunderstorms are expected in the Alps, with heavier showers across the north on Friday afternoon.
We’re being urged to take precautions as the heat builds toward the weekend.
